Salt Lake City , United States

Salt Lake City, nestled between the Great Salt Lake and the Wasatch Mountains, is a unique blend of urban sophistication and outdoor adventure. Known for its stunning natural beauty, rich history, and vibrant cultural scene, it offers a distinctive experience for travelers. The city is a gateway to world-class skiing, hiking, and cultural attractions, making it a versatile destination for all types of travelers.

Quick Facts

Nickname

The Crossroads of the West

Elevation

1,288 meters (4,226 feet)

Population

200,000 (city proper), 1.2 million (metropolitan area)

Climate

Semi-arid/Continental - Salt Lake City experiences four distinct seasons with cold, snowy winters and warm, dry summers. The city is known for its powdery snow, which attracts winter sports enthusiasts. Spring and fall are mild and pleasant, making them popular times for outdoor activities.

Best Time to Visit

Peak Season

December to February (winter) and June to August (summer)

Winter is ideal for skiing and snowboarding, while summer offers hiking, biking, and festivals. These are the busiest times with the most activities and events.

Shoulder Season

March to May and September to November

Mild weather with fewer crowds. Great for outdoor activities and sightseeing without the peak season prices and crowds.
